Abstract

The creation of a web-based information system at the North Jakarta Sunter branch of Kumon tutoring is intended to improve service quality and quality in the implementation of teaching and learning activities. Based on this, this study will develop a web-based information system that includes an interface design, namely the main page, login, subjects, schedule of subjects, and grades. Making this system an effort to optimize service performance to students.
